koa typeorm starter
1.0.0
用於使用typeScript和typeorm使用KOA的入門項目
package-lock.json設置數據庫,並確保將配置更改為自己的設置。您可以在開發環境下找到config/ormconfig.json下的數據庫配置。相應地更改為您選擇的環境(開發/測試/生產)
{
"type": "postgres",
"host": "localhost",
"port": 5432,
"username": "username",
"password": "password",
"database": "database",
"logging": false
}
有關更多信息,例如支持的數據庫驅動程序訪問TypeOmm。
並通過在終端中運行此應用程序開始您的應用程序。這將注意更改並重建(transped)您的申請
$ npm run debug
這樣,您可以在終端中看到該應用程序可以聆聽請求的記錄。例如:
[2018-06-04T01:55:18.426Z] [info]: Server started at http://localhost:3000 NODE_ENV=development
為了在生產中運行,該終端運行:
$ npm run start
如果要使用pm2檢查它是ecosystem.config.json和Run:
$ npm run pm2
另外,如果您在dirname/logs中運行
要運行測試套件,請輸入終端
$ npm run test
或按測試類型
$ npm run e2e:test
$ npm run unit:test
開放請求請求!
非常感謝JM Santos的類似快速入門